3 Baysdale Avenue is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Corby (NN17 1TL). It has a recorded floor area of 67 m² (around 721 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. At 67 m² this is the 4th smallest of 17 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 64–102 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 17 units on file. The latest certificate (August 2019)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 73).
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 13.9%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£160,000 is 20.3%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£184/sq ft) was about 43.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: November 2019 at £133,000.
